
光影创作的基石,理解渲染管线
要创作我的世界光影,首先必须理解游戏渲染的核心框架,我的世界使用固定的图形管线,这意味着光影创作者需要在其既定的结构内进行工作,光影包本质上是一系列着色器程序的集合,它们替换了游戏原有的渲染逻辑,这些着色器通常用GLSL语言编写,它们负责处理从顶点变换到最终像素颜色的每一个步骤,创作者需要熟悉光照模型,理解法线贴图环境光遮蔽阴影映射等概念,这是将方块世界转化为动人景色的第一步。
从零开始,准备你的工具与知识
动手创作前,你需要装备合适的工具,一款代码编辑器如Visual Studio Code是必不可少的,用于编写和修改GLSL代码,同时你需要一个基础的光影包作为模板,许多优秀创作者的作品是开源的可供学习,深入理解图形学基础知识至关重要,包括向量矩阵颜色空间以及光照的物理原理,我的世界的方块美学有其独特性,如何让硬朗的方块边缘呈现柔和的光影,如何让水体天空云层显得自然,这些都需要在代码与审美之间找到平衡。
核心模块剖析,构建光影的骨骼
一个完整的光影包由多个关键模块组成,首先是顶点着色器,它决定几何体如何被投射到屏幕上,其次是片段着色器,这是光影的灵魂,它计算每个像素最终的颜色,光照计算在这里发生,环境光直射光漫反射与镜面高光都在此交织,阴影映射让物体投下真实的阴影,水体着色器赋予水面折射反射与波纹,天空着色器创造从日出到日落的动态天穹,体积云与体积光则增添了空间的深度与神圣感,每个模块都像精密齿轮,共同驱动视觉奇迹。
调试与优化,让光影流畅运行
创作不仅是实现效果,更是无尽的调试与优化,你需要在游戏中反复加载光影,观察每一处瑕疵,颜色是否溢出,阴影是否闪烁,水面反射是否穿帮,性能是严峻挑战,过于复杂的光影计算会让帧数暴跌,创作者必须学会优化代码,减少冗余计算,合理使用渲染分辨率缩放,我的世界光影必须在视觉震撼与硬件负担间取得完美妥协,这是一个不断测试调整再测试的过程,需要极大的耐心与细致。
分享与迭代,融入社区的洪流
当你的光影包初步完成,分享给社区是激动人心的时刻,将作品发布到相关平台,接收来自全球玩家的反馈与赞美,也直面批评与建议,其他玩家会报告各种显卡下的兼容性问题,会提出新的功能设想,真正的创作循环于此开始,你需要根据反馈持续迭代,修复错误,提升效果,甚至加入自定义选项让玩家调整,我的世界光影创作从来不是孤高的艺术,它是创作者与玩家共同编织的视觉梦想。
光影创作之旅是一条融合了技术理性与艺术感性的道路,每一行代码都是投向方块世界的一束光,每一次调试都是对完美画面的执着追求,当玩家漫步在你创造的光影中,为壮丽的日落或静谧的夜雨而驻足感叹,那一刻所有深夜的付出都拥有了意义,这不仅仅是技术的展示,更是通过数字之手传递美与沉浸感的独特方式,邀请每一位有心者拿起工具,开始书写属于自己的光影诗篇。
相关文章